Transaction 24243aeff73bfabbcba9602712c69676abfe527d97ca954e30fc7afbfde83d90
1 Input
2 Outputs
- 24243aeff73bfabbcba9602712c69676abfe527d97ca954e30fc7afbfde83d90:0
- 24243aeff73bfabbcba9602712c69676abfe527d97ca954e30fc7afbfde83d90:1
value 582277
address 15aHs5DCMH4bRPJqG5jsKPea7mxRZWiYu9
value 816029
address 12YkiG4ahzpgp5hSM8A4wfZ8gwpa2f6kkE